## Deployment

Starting this sprint, Harborlace ships on the slimmed base image. We dropped the debug toolchain, switched to a distroless runtime, and multi-stage builds now prune dev dependencies, cutting the image from 1.4 GB to 210 MB. Cold-start times improved noticeably in canary. Anyone deploying manually should pull the new tag; the old fat image is deprecated and will be removed next month. The build pipeline uses the following configuration:

deployment values, kajep-kageg:
[praix]
host = praix.paliqcorp.corp
user = praix_svc
database = praix_prod

**Ticket: VLT-backed credentials unavailable during ORM refactor**

While migrating the legacy Quillstone ORM layer to the new repository pattern, the schema-migration job lost its session with the Coffervault secrets store. The vault auto-locked after three failed unseal attempts triggered by stale connection strings baked into the old mapper classes. Migration is paused at step 14 of 22; rollback is not required. To resume, the on-call engineer must manually unseal Coffervault using the recovery passphrase below.

recovery phrase for bafof-kajof: quenmir-ralmir-praeth

**Q: When does Burrowpipe actually compact a topic's log?**

Short version: compaction kicks in once a partition's dirty ratio crosses 0.5, not on a schedule, so don't panic if old keys linger for a bit after a release. Tombstones hang around for 24 hours before they're swept. If you need to force a compaction pass before cutting a release, use the admin CLI's compact-now command — but it prompts for the cluster recovery passphrase first. Current value for this quarter is:

strongbox words: wenix-ulador

### Rate-Parity Checker API

Contractor notes: the Lodgemark parity service scans partner booking feeds hourly and flags rooms where the direct rate exceeds any channel rate by more than 1%. Query `/parity/flags` for open discrepancies; POST `/parity/scan` to force a recheck on one property. Results cache for 15 minutes. All internal calls require auth. Use the staging service key below.

gateway credential: kto3_qfe